If that's the case then it is probably people voting by force of habit more than anything else... My mother, for example, is a dyed-in-the-wool Liberal. It's what she has voted for just about, ever.
She was horribly offended when my wife and I had an NDP sign on our lawn last election.
You could also point to the strong support from the immigrant population that resides in and around Toronto... they largely support the Liberals because of the Libs progressive immigration policies. Who knows how much effect the same sex marriage issue will come to bear on this traditional voter base (did you see all the leaders at the Seikh Temple shilling for votes? Make no mistake that was directly related to the fact that there are votes to get there because many Seikh's are pissed about the same sex legislation).
"My hands are on fire. Hands are on fire. Ain't got no more time for all you charlatans and liars."
- Old Man Luedecke